A175894 a(n) = sigma(d(n)) where d(n) is n-th divisor of 101010 (n=1..64). 0

%I #8 Nov 27 2015 17:07:28

%S 1,3,4,6,12,8,18,14,24,24,32,42,72,48,38,56,96,84,144,114,168,112,192,

%T 152,252,336,228,336,576,456,304,448,684,1008,672,532,912,1344,912,

%U 1216,2016,1596,2736,1824,2688,2128,3648,3192,5472,8064,6384,4256,7296,9576

%N a(n) = sigma(d(n)) where d(n) is n-th divisor of 101010 (n=1..64).

%C 101010 is the 71st birthday of NJAS!

%t DivisorSigma[1,#]&/@Divisors[101010] (* _Harvey P. Dale_, Nov 27 2015 *)

%o (PARI) dv=divisors(101010);for(n=1,#dv,print1(sigma(dv[n]),", "))
